Refocusing & Collimating Fiber/Lens Objectives
Specifications
| Center Wavelength: | 10000 nm |
|---|---|
| Bandwidth: | Not Specified |
| Numerical Aperture: | 0.35 |
| Effective Focal Length (EFL): | 20 mm |
| Z-Translation Stage: | Adjustable in ±5 mm range |
| Lens Material: | ZnSe or Ge (on request) |
| Lend Diameter: | Ø15 mm |
| Focal Length: | f = 20 mm or 10 mm (on request) |
| AR Coating: | 3-5.5µm or 8-12µm (on request) |
Features
- Compatibility: This objective is fully compatible with SMA-terminated fiber cables, ensuring seamless integration into your existing setup.
- Numerical Aperture (NA): With an NA of 0.35 and a pupil diameter of 14 mm, this objective delivers exceptional light gathering capabilities.
- Refocusing or Collimating Design: Switch effortlessly between refocusing a collimated beam into a fiber or collimating the output beam from a fiber, depending on your experimental requirements.
Applications
- Focusing of collimated beam into fiber
- Collimation of output beam from fiber
- Fiber end imagination to detector / emitter element
